7 Apps to Teach Kids About Money

Success

Budgeting and building credit are only the beginning—you also have student loans, mortgage rates and maybe even cryptocurrency and non-fungible tokens (NFTs). Meanwhile, only 21 states required a personal finance course for high school students in 2020, according to the Council for Economic Education. What is a busy parent to do?

Is Mint the Best Budgeting App for Me?

Success

Finding the best budgeting app for you can be tricky since there are multiple options, and each is slightly different. Often appearing on lists of the best budgeting apps, Mint is one of the most popular and easy-to-use apps available. How does the Mint budgeting app work? What is the Mint app?
